Go CLI that turns the markdown currency of this stack (Redmine notes, Discourse posts, briefing output) into typeset PDFs: two embedded typst templates (report with title page/TOC/headers, dense brief), front-matter (title/subtitle/author/date/classification/template), GFM tables, and bar charts rendered in pure Go (go-chart) from fenced chart data blocks. Engine is a prebuilt typst 0.15.1 container pinned by digest and run --network none; PDF bytes to stdout or -o. Exit codes 0/1/2. All dev in docker (dev.sh/Makefile); unit tests + golden typst fixtures plus a host-side smoke against the real engine container. Generated with Crush Assisted-by: Crush:glm-5.2
